There are many industries where a scale would need to be waterproof (as well as shock-resistant,). Some of these include:

* foodservice.
* food processing

* medical care
* chemical plants
* outdoor use
* veterinary use
* many industrial manufacturing
* shipping and receiving
* laboratories
* pharmacies
* livestock farming

In many of these applications, a scale is used as an integral part of their daily operations. Thus, they require a scale that is both highly accurate (such as a digital one), and one that is well built to hold up to the rigors of a work environment in which various kinds of liquids may come in contact with the surface of the device.

The following are additional features you should look for in a digital waterproof scale:

* Measurements in grams, pounds, pound/ounces or just ounces
* Stainless steel construction, including load sensors
* Easily portable
* Automatic zero tare function
* Full scale pushbutton operation for tare and zero
* Compensation for temperature and humidity
* Clear LCD display
* Battery or AC operation
* Automatic power-down after five minutes of inactivity, in order to lengthen battery life
* Welded housing of the display (to protect the sensitive part of the equipment)

For heavy-duty waterproof digital scales, look for stainless steel load sensors; they will provide much better durability, consistency, overload protection and rust/corrosion resistance than the less-expensive aluminum or nickel-plated load cells of lower-priced scales. You want to make sure that if you are weighing livestock for instance, the shock and pressure of a heifer stepping on to the device will not wear out it’s all important load sensors too soon. After all, an industrial quality waterproof scale is a hefty investment.
